Abstract

PROCEDIMIENTO PARA LA FABRICACION, DE OBJETOS DE BORURO DE TITANIO FRITADOS TERMICAMENTE. COMPRENDE LAS SIGUIENTES OPERACIONES: PRIMERA, SE PREPARA UN POLVO A FRITAR A BASE DE BORURO DE TITANIO QUE CONTIENE, COMO ADITIVOS DE DENSIFICADO, HIDRURO DE TITANIO Y BORO, SIENDO LA PROPORCION RELATIVA DE ESTOS ADITIVOS DE UN MOL DE TIH POR CADA DOS MOLES DE BORO; SEGUNDA, SE INTRODUCE DICHO POLVO A FRITAR EN UN MOLDE O MATRIZ QUE TENGA LA FORMA DEL OBJETO DESEADO Y SE SOMETE A UNA PRESION ISOSTATICA; TERCERA, SE DESMOLDEA EL OBJETO Y SE CALIENTA BAJO VACIO CON EL FIN DE DESGASIFICAR Y DE PROVOCAR LA DESCOMPOSICION DEL HIDRURO DE TITANIO E HIDROGENO; Y POR ULTIMO, SE CALIENTA EL OBJETO A UNA TEMPERATURA COMPRENDIDA ENTRE 1800 Y 2200 GRADOS EN UNA ATMOSFERA INERTE, PARA PROVOCAR EL FRITADO Y EL DENSIFICADO DEL MISMO.
